Robert Ronis★★★★★Tim Hortons is the ultimate money saver when you're at an event at the PPL center. They have hot food, sweets, coffee/tea/fountain drinks. For a hockey game we all get a chili and drink. It's a HUGE difference in $$ than getting food in the arena. The quality is good. The chili is obviously mass produced and in a bag before serving, but it's a hockey game not a 5 star restaurant. Staff is friendly but seem overwhelmed or understaffed. Line moves quickly. Clean and easily accessible from inside the PPL center.
